Here are a few answers to the questions on Assamese legend Zubeen Garg's death - when and where he died.
What is the real cause of Zubeen Garg's death and why was he in Singapore at the time of his demise?
Q1: What happened to Zubeen Garg?
Zubeen Garg suffered a seizure attack while swimming at Lazarus Island in Singapore on September 19, 2025. Despite immediate medical attention at Singapore General Hospital, he passed away at the age of 52.
Q2: Where did Zubeen Garg die?
He died in Singapore at Singapore General Hospital, after being rushed there from Lazarus Island.
Q3: Why was Zubeen Garg in Singapore?
Zubeen Garg was in Singapore as the cultural brand ambassador for the 4th North East India Festival at Suntec Convention Centre, where he was scheduled to perform on September 20, 2025.
Q4: How old was Zubeen Garg when he died?
He was 52 years old at the time of his untimely death.
Q5: Was Zubeen Garg scuba diving when he died?
No. His wife, Garima Saikia Garg, clarified that he was not scuba diving. He was swimming with friends when he suffered a seizure attack.
Q6: Who are some famous personalities who paid tribute to Zubeen Garg?
Prime Minister Narendra Modi, Union Home Minister Amit Shah, Assam Chief Minister Himanta Biswa Sarma, Bollywood actor Adil Hussain, and singer Jubin Nautiyal were among those who paid tribute.
Q7: What will happen to Zubeen Garg’s mortal remains?
His body will be flown to
Delhi and then to
Guwahati, where it will be kept at the
Sarusajai Sports Complex for the public to pay their respects before the final rites.
